Output c31e895ba443586cdfb568e30e1fb8497ad21b2e11d1912c76bd85605f40fc04:17

value
8830000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9e90beab832de8b5e56997e02de47768fe556673 OP_EQUAL
address
A6tgpk81bDGCJgaMKzanUQcx9XWAYmdeFf
transaction
c31e895ba443586cdfb568e30e1fb8497ad21b2e11d1912c76bd85605f40fc04